|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
| |
Use /proc/pid/cmdline instead of /proc/pid/stat
to filter process by name.
Bug: 8638853
Change-Id: I469f55186e0d8b93311438cc8a1d0f73834f3fb5
|
|
|
|
|
| |
Bug: 17913995
Change-Id: Ib8359345f3194780ae50019292c2746eb21a7612
|
|
|
|
| |
Change-Id: I850dd9995a8ad6cb1f606cca2f57d7dbba2f40ed
|
|
|
|
| |
Change-Id: Idad77b6ddc0abe270edff773bb0316d30b9f894d
|
|
|
|
|
|
|
|
|
| |
You can't use $(TARGET_BUILD_VARIANT) to change how a module
is built like this makefile used to.
Change-Id: Ie6a274cab9a77eb2376a9494e9c17aae8ba0ee0b
Signed-off-by: Olivier Fourdan <olivier.fourdan@intel.com>
Signed-off-by: Guilhem IMBERTON <guilhem.imberton@intel.com>
|
|
|
|
| |
Change-Id: I402e68f843e9673e1c02e4f84f4832380c0e91ac
|
|
|
|
|
| |
Bug: 17000769
Change-Id: I6b218b4c2ba3f57d344f60af7a25c45f07091d64
|
|
|
|
|
|
|
|
|
|
| |
Use more upstream NetBSD, and update those things that were already NetBSD.
Note that unlike bionic, the upstream-netbsd directory isn't pristine; we have
changes marked by __ANDROID__.
Bug: 16493461
Change-Id: I99762bfe02caa0945ea4a184670888a4b5435a1d
|
|\ |
|
| |
| |
| |
| | |
Change-Id: Idd1635673e01758b5a7d34f1fdfbb695296c6164
|
|\ \ |
|
| |/
| |
| |
| |
| |
| |
| | |
Also modernize the Android-specific hacks.
Bug: https://code.google.com/p/android/issues/detail?id=70793
Change-Id: I2aebcd2ff10ca2466017379d87f5fabdb77c05e2
|
|/
|
|
|
|
|
|
|
|
|
|
| |
netd is supposed to be restarted when the zygote is restarted (see the
"onrestart" section for "service zygote" in init.zygote*.rc). But this
only works if you send a restart command (say via "ctl.restart").
"stop && start" != "restart". It seems ingrained in developers to do
"stop && start", so we don't have much hope of convincing everyone to
switch to "adb shell restart", even if we did add such a toolbox command.
Bug: 15855807
Change-Id: I387fe86600f4a2862abc3a05a2ef9a1e7374e21d
|
|
|
|
| |
Change-Id: Ied4adacde94ee10deb30647156f07d46a38fbe1f
|
|
|
|
| |
Change-Id: Ie1da2e95ee7e3513afb87f357be983dc80cd1515
|
|
|
|
|
| |
Change-Id: I579d2046f96ba8ae9fd0bf8f36e2e2f64da622ea
Signed-off-by: Rocky Zhang <zhangyan.hit@gmail.com>
|
|
|
|
| |
Change-Id: I541d1f4efac3c91d1a26f60735c72e799490fcc9
|
|
|
|
|
| |
Signed-off-by: Chris Dearman <chris@mips.com>
Change-Id: Iee72a6b987e4ec1c720e925b59e9e2631ae978e5
|
|
|
|
| |
Change-Id: I46586cba83ecb8095721be8ffad9e386d4698e4a
|
|
|
|
|
| |
Change-Id: I6c500ab55470155ddf692fe5f655bdd575f195f5
Signed-off-by: Sasha Levitskiy <sanek@google.com>
|
|
|
|
|
| |
Change-Id: I2f7d9934b54d98886d7a6205ea122d9ce91066ec
Signed-off-by: Dmitry Shmidt <dimitrysh@google.com>
|
|
|
|
|
|
|
|
|
| |
It doesn't make any sense for the C library to contain private stuff
that's only used by toolbox. Rather than move that stuff out of bionic
and into here, let's just use the same MD5 implementation the rest of
the system's using.
Change-Id: Ia1c73164124094b532af3453b90c4bd1ebfdaa24
|
|
|
|
|
| |
Bug: 14903517
Change-Id: I5b0a418dd982f1a2fd90609b12bd8364f7f34996
|
|
|
|
|
| |
Change-Id: Iadedae749b31adb1310fa50a68b2dc19097c3654
Signed-off-by: Greg Hackmann <ghackmann@google.com>
|
|
|
|
|
| |
Change-Id: I4d37ae4ad19620f77e37b739fb1248b712b3f986
Signed-off-by: Greg Hackmann <ghackmann@google.com>
|
|\ |
|
| |
| |
| |
| |
| |
| |
| |
| |
| | |
- Deal with some signedness issues
- Deal with some size issues
- Deal with NULL pointer issues
- Deal with some -Wunused issues
Change-Id: I1479dd90d690084491bae3475f2c547833519a57
|
|\ \ |
|
| |/
| |
| |
| |
| |
| |
| |
| |
| | |
Would've been nice if we could use the sys property
observer to start and stop all services in a service
class but service classes do not appear to be fully
supported.
Change-Id: Iaf17a2dbcf913c4c646bc1e8e13adee9f952c45e
|
|\ \ |
|
| |/
| |
| |
| |
| |
| |
| | |
Allow us to easily identify the 32/64 bitness of the process. Yes, I
know this is not technically an ABI, but it seemed close enough!
Change-Id: Ia03a17fd74d61e7619911cb26b3dd7d82b62930c
|
|/
|
|
|
| |
Bug: 14970171
Change-Id: I6f54c35e265b849be914120f795c9f8e0cec34bb
|
|\ |
|
| |
| |
| |
| |
| | |
Bug: 14166609
Change-Id: I4aad1e0db2e875735405d094fb0d1a36862b5b19
|
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
Patch for https://code.google.com/p/android/issues/detail?id=68268
A length check for the argv[2] was added in order to prevent buffer
overflow. Also replace strcpy with strlcpy.
Signed-off-by: nks <nks@sixserv.org>
Change-Id: If65b83e9b658315c672e684f64e3ae00e69fac31
|
|/
|
|
| |
Change-Id: Ib706d3a536c409810cfbc47270448c6375314506
|
|
|
|
| |
Change-Id: Ia538c7177f8d5cf2c1f0efb5b575da6527c13968
|
|
|
|
| |
Change-Id: I77b8ca2c32b9ff33abb6acadae47f0ab47b47907
|
|
|
|
| |
Change-Id: I4b6f2e0015f8cfa18400fa4bd08460a07e29a51b
|
|
|
|
|
|
|
|
|
| |
uid_from_user doesn't need to cope with numeric ids in the BSD code
like it did with the old Android code; the caller now handles those.
Also explain what SUPPORT_DOT is for.
Change-Id: I185c9f02b7039795069aa30545563b8a6ef54cd5
|
|\ |
|
| |
| |
| |
| | |
Change-Id: I45381b8a04f4cb651123a2d43860418e06df6e65
|
|/
|
|
|
|
| |
bionic has getline now.
Change-Id: I5e4ee137768ab3113dbe8a07406fa39f4b6546af
|
|
|
|
|
|
| |
(<asm/page.h> is going away.)
Change-Id: Id0d7ad0eb791cd47490c48458f9f8a6468ddf5c9
|
|
|
|
|
|
|
| |
This depends on change I137588013ed1750315702c0dbe088ce3e4a29e83.
Change-Id: I5a4fef9affd6cddf98d72dc9d54899be25741779
Signed-off-by: Stephen Smalley <sds@tycho.nsa.gov>
|
|\ |
|
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
libselinux selinux_android_restorecon API is changing to the more
general interface with flags and dropping the older variants.
Also get rid of the old, no longer used selinux_android_setfilecon API
and rename selinux_android_setfilecon2 to it as it is the only API in use.
Change-Id: I1e71ec398ccdc24cac4ec76f1b858d0f680f4925
Signed-off-by: Stephen Smalley <sds@tycho.nsa.gov>
|
|/
|
|
|
|
| |
We only have uapi headers now.
Change-Id: I2c02e10bb3bba4006579772f3ab2a18c2df7535d
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Extend the libselinux restorecon implementation to allow reuse
by the toolbox restorecon command. This simply requires adding
support for the nochange (-n) and verbose (-v) options to the
libselinux functions and rewriting the toolbox restorecon command
to use the libselinux functions. Also add a force (-F) option to
support forcing a restorecon_recursive even if the restorecon_last
attribute matches the current file_contexts hash so that we can
continue to force a restorecon via the toolbox command for testing
or when we know something else has changed (e.g. for when we support
relabeling /data/data and package information has changed).
Change-Id: I92bb3259790a7195ba56a5e9555c3b6c76ceb862
Signed-off-by: Stephen Smalley <sds@tycho.nsa.gov>
|
|
|
|
| |
Change-Id: I8332a0a8045a70b3992fe34b0b9e334a721265a9
|